Nova Scotia rider wins team silver at Pan Am Games

    Brittany Fraser is making a name for herself in the international world of dressage. Fraser, 27, of New Glasgow, Nova Scotia, and her teammates earned the team silver medal in dressage for Canada at the Pan American Games in Toronto in July. Coached by Canadian four-time Olympian Ashley Holzer, Fraser is fully committed to becoming the best the sport has to offer. 
    Fraser’s father, Craig, who owns a construction business, has been her major sponsor. Her father encouraged her to ride at four, and her stepmother, Kathryn Fraser, taught her the fundamentals. She honed her skills as a teenager with Ruth Koch, an Ottawa-area Level III dressage coach, and trained with German coach, Albrecht Heidemann, in Canada’s Future Young Riders Select Training Program (FYRST).  (read more)
